Established in 2021 by KC founding father Mr. Kith Chhoeurn, Morodok Basedth has since grown into something larger than one person — a young, mixed-background team of co-founders who took the risk of planting where there was only empty land, choosing to build something green along the slopes of Phnom Sleuk mountain.

Every visitor's presence flows back to the people who did that planting. This is not agritourism as marketing. It is agritourism as an operating model — soil, team, and visitor all part of the same continuing story.

AUTHENTIC_MENU — FARM_TO_TABLE

  • Snakehead Fish Sour Soup
    ម្ជូរយួន

    Wild snakehead fish from local waters. Lemongrass, fresh galangal, and seasonal vegetables from within the farm boundary. Our most celebrated broth.

    signature
  • Countryside Chicken Sour Soup
    ម្ជូរមាន់ស្រែ

    Raised by the farmers of Basedth — fed on open ground, not a cage. Slow-cooked with tamarind and the sour notes that define Kampong Speu countryside cooking.

    farm chicken
  • Charcoal-Grilled Farm Chicken
    មាន់អាំងធ្យូង

    Whole or half, over charcoal, with fermented fish dipping sauce and fresh herbs from the farm. Best eaten with your hands as the sun goes down.

    farm chicken
  • Prahok with Kresang
    ប្រហុកឆៅចិញ្ចំក្រសាំង

    Fermented fish paste paired with Kresang — an ancestral preparation that few places still make with integrity. We do not make it for tourists. We make it because it is ours.

    heritage
  • Farm-Fresh BBQ
    អាំងស្រស់

    Charcoal-grilled produce harvested the same morning. Best enjoyed as the sun descends over the 3-hectare pond.

  • Guided Farm Walk & Pick Your Own Papaya
    ដើរទស្សនាចំការ

    Join our farm guides to understand the full journey from soil to table. Take a papaya home. Book in advance.

[06] GETTING_HERE

One hour from
the city.
Far enough to matter.

Close enough for a half-day. Far enough that the city actually disappears. Morodok Basedth is accessible by expressway or National Road 4 — for a morning run, a family day, a corporate retreat, or a night under the stars.

  • LOCATIONTrapeang Thlok Village, Basedth District, Kampong Speu
  • DISTANCE70 km from Phnom Penh · ~1 hour by car
  • ROUTESExpressway (recommended) or National Road 4
  • HOURSOpen daily · Overnight camping · 24/7 security on-site
  • PARKINGFree · Private vehicles and group buses
